Mini Pupils Each year, Chambers offer a limited number of Mini-Pupillages for applicants aged 18 or over. Successful applicants will spend 3 to 5 days in Chambers and where possible, Mini-Pupillages will be tailored to suit candidates preferred areas of law.
On your Mini-Pupillage, you will attend court with Members of Chambers, and may be asked to assist with paperwork.
Mini-pupils must ensure that they are appropriately dressed when at Court, in Chambers or on Chambers’ business. Dark suits must be worn. Male mini-pupils must wear a tie. Female mini-pupils may wear trouser suits if they wish.
Applications are to be made by CV and covering letter to Lee Young, Head of Pupillage. Applications must be received by 1st March for a Mini-Pupillage during the summer of the same year. Applicants will be notified of the outcome of their application by mid-March, where they will be offered to contact Chambers for making suitable arrangements for their commencement of Mini-Pupillage.
All mini-pupils are required to sign a declaration of confidentiality prior to commencement of their Mini-Pupillage.
